The Future of Traditional Okinawan Goju Ryu 

 

The Okinawan Goju Ryu Kenkyu Kai Executive Committee voted unanimously to change the name of the organization to Koryu Koshu Kai, meaning Old Style of Ancient Methods Association. This name change will better represent that we are an organization that knows, practices, teaches, and preserves the older ways of Okinawan Karate, that are becoming scarcer with each passing year and the passing away of masters who knew and shared the old ways. 

In addition, there are many organizations that are named similar to our former name. There is even one identical name to ours that named their organization the same name as ours eleven years after we named ours. These similar names are confusing to new perspective members. 

We have created a new LLC, new patches, this new website, and new certificates.  Our name now aligns with who we are and what we teach.  We also teach and preserve Okinawan Kobudo, but not just one system of Okinawan Kobudo.
